 What is Interlibrary Loan?

Interlibrary Loan (ILL) is a cooperative system for libraries to share resources. Books, articles, and media that are not part of the LSC collections can be requested. There is no charge for the service, but normal library circulation rules apply for any items borrowed.

ILL is only available to LSC faculty, students, and staff. Guest borrowers and other members of the area community can make requests through their local public library. We are always happy to help everyone find information on books and articles.

 Make an Interlibrary Loan Request for an Item We Don't Own Minimize

To request an article in a magazine, journal, newspaper or other periodical:

  • Make sure you have the complete citation of the article you need.
  • Check Find Full Text Journals: EBSCO A-to-Z on the library home page to see if the article is available in the library print collection or in any of our online databases.
  • If you need help with this process, come to the library reference desk or call 626-6450 for help.
  • If the article is not available in our resources, fill out the Article Request Form.
  • We will send a copy of the article to your LSC email account as an attachment. If you've made a request, be sure to be on the lookout for a message from ILL.  The entire process: request to your receiving the article almost always happens electronically.
To request a book or media item:
  • If the title is found in the VSC Libraries Online Catalog, click on "Place Request" while you are looking at the "Details" for the item.
  • Use "Multiple Library Search" (on the menu bar within the online catalog) if the item you want doesn't appear in the VSC catalog. One of the larger academic libraries on the list or a public library in Vermont is likely to have the title you want.
  • If you do not find the title in either of the searches above, use the Book or Media Request Form. Make sure you have the complete citation for the item.
If you need help with the process, come to the library reference desk, or call 626-6450.
